The surge in investments in industrial automation is poised to significantly drive the demand for pneumatic components, given their integral role in powering devices used in this sector through compressed air. This momentum aligns with the continuous growth of Industrial Internet of Things (IIoT) and the ever-expanding realm of predictive analytics, showcasing a trend that shows no signs of slowing down. Pneumatic devices and controls are pivotal players in this movement, continually advancing to enhance and smarten automation and control processes. The versatility of pneumatic systems is increasingly evident in various industrial applications, and the integration of new sensing and data communication technologies is making pneumatics more intelligent and easily adaptable to the Industrial Internet of Things.
Looking ahead, the evolution of smart sensing technologies is expected to play a crucial role in shaping the future of pneumatics. The incorporation of affordable sensing and information processing technology is becoming a standard feature in various fluid power equipment components, spanning from connectors, tubing, and hoses to pneumatic cylinders, actuators, and filters.
In parallel, remarkable strides have been made in the field of robotics within industrial automation. Notably, the impact of robotics-driven factory automation and artificial intelligence is exemplified by Amazon's ability to deliver around five billion items in just two days in 2018. Pneumatic components, particularly pneumatic actuators, contribute significantly to these advancements in industrial automation. The utilization of wireless sensors and valve controls in advanced pneumatic actuators not only enhances their performance but also enables predictive maintenance capabilities.
A noteworthy recent development in industrial automation is the introduction of a pneumatically powered production cell designed for low-cost automation applications. This innovative cell has the potential to elevate production efficiency and output quality at an economical cost.
